Dear Editor
As President of Nederland Area Seniors (NAS), I wanted to take a moment to express my heartfelt gratitude for the support and participation that made this year’s Nederland Jazz and Wine Festival a tremendous success. This was the third year, and what a remarkable community event it was!
I am deeply appreciative of the volunteer time and community support provided for the event. Our quirky community may be nestled in the mountains, but we never run out of new ideas and surprises.
I want to express my gratitude to the festival staff and crew for their openness to new ideas and their unwavering dedication, even when the work becomes challenging. It’s these collective efforts that make moments like these truly worthwhile.
Thank you, thank you, thank you!
Sincerely,
Guy D. Falsetti
President, Nederland Area Seniors
